What is the Quitclaim Deed Husband And Wife To Three Individuals Texas
A quitclaim deed is a legal document used to transfer ownership of real property from one party to another without any warranties or guarantees. In Texas, when a husband and wife execute a quitclaim deed to transfer property to three individuals, it signifies that they are relinquishing any claim to the property without asserting any rights or interests. This type of deed is often used in situations such as divorce settlements, family transfers, or estate planning. It is important to understand that a quitclaim deed does not guarantee that the property is free of liens or other encumbrances.
Steps to Complete the Quitclaim Deed Husband And Wife To Three Individuals Texas
Completing a quitclaim deed in Texas involves several key steps to ensure the document is legally valid. First, both spouses must agree on the transfer and gather necessary information, including the legal description of the property and the names of the individuals receiving the property. Next, the couple should fill out the quitclaim deed form accurately, ensuring all parties' names are spelled correctly and the property description is precise. After completing the form, both spouses must sign it in the presence of a notary public. Finally, the signed quitclaim deed must be filed with the county clerk's office where the property is located to make the transfer official.
Legal Use of the Quitclaim Deed Husband And Wife To Three Individuals Texas
The quitclaim deed is recognized legally in Texas, provided it meets specific requirements. For a quitclaim deed to be valid, it must be executed by the grantors (the husband and wife), contain a clear description of the property, and be signed in front of a notary public. Additionally, the deed must be recorded with the county clerk to protect the interests of the new owners against future claims. It is crucial to note that using a quitclaim deed does not eliminate any existing liens or debts associated with the property, which can still affect the new owners.
Key Elements of the Quitclaim Deed Husband And Wife To Three Individuals Texas
Several key elements must be included in a quitclaim deed for it to be effective. These include the names of the grantors (husband and wife), the names of the grantees (three individuals), a legal description of the property being transferred, and the date of execution. It is also essential to include a statement indicating that the grantors are transferring their interest in the property without any warranties. Additionally, the signatures of both spouses must be notarized to validate the document legally.
State-Specific Rules for the Quitclaim Deed Husband And Wife To Three Individuals Texas
In Texas, specific rules govern the execution and recording of quitclaim deeds. The state requires that all quitclaim deeds be signed by the grantors in the presence of a notary public. Furthermore, the deed must be filed with the county clerk's office to be enforceable against third parties. Texas law also mandates that the deed contain a legal description of the property, which can be obtained from the county appraisal district or previous property records. Failure to comply with these requirements may result in the deed being deemed invalid.
